Abstract

Novel heterocyclic compounds of the formula I in which R, R, R, R, R, R, R, R, Rand Rhave the meanings indicated in Claimare activators of glucokinase and can be used for the prevention and/or treatment of Diabetes Typ 1 and 2, obesity, neuropathy and/or nephropathy.
